Dr. Annaraud has worked for an international auditing company in St. Petersburg, Russia and for Pricewaterhouse Coopers LLP in Detroit, Michigan. Her hospitality industry experience was gained through work in a Russian-Greek travel agency in St. Petersburg and Athens, and she has held several internships in hotels and restaurants in the U.S. and her native Russia. Her primary research interests include hospitality accounting, finance and cost control.
